HB1172

Relative to confidentiality protections for national guard sexual assault prevention and response personnel.

Complete·6/1/26

HB1172 strengthens confidentiality protections for New Hampshire National Guard sexual assault prevention and response personnel.

HB1172 amends RSA 173-C:1, V to redefine "sexual assault counselor" to include military and civilian personnel involved in sexual assault prevention and response. These personnel, certified by the Department of Defense, include the principal sexual assault response coordinator, sexual assault response coordinators, and victim advocates. The bill aims to ensure confidentiality of communications between victims and these counselors, enhancing protections for those who provide support to victims of sexual assault or attempted sexual assault.
